The Pāli Canon, or Tipiṭaka (ti—three + piṭaka—basket), consists of the … The climate of Theravāda countries is not conducive to the survival of manuscripts. Apart from brief quotations in inscriptions and a two-page fragment from the eighth or ninth century found in Nepal, the oldest manuscripts known are from late in the fifteenth century, and there is not very much from before the eighteenth. The first complete printed edition of the Canon was published in Burma in 1900, in 38 volumes. …

WebThe Pali Text Society was founded in 1881 by T.W. Rhys Davids 'to foster and promote the study of Pāli texts'. The society publishes Pāli texts in roman characters, translations in English, and ancillary works including dictionaries, a concordance, books for students of Pāli, and a journal.
